    I updated to 3.5 last week and my galleries don’t work properly anymore ever since. Before, I used the Lightbox Gallery plugin. However, when I insert a gallery and click on a picture on my website, I get a messed-up frame without a picture in it instead of an enlarged picture like it’s supposed to show. When I deactivate the plugin and click one of the gallery pictures, I am redirected to a new page where the picture is shown.

    I would very much love to be able to view the pictures like I used to with Lightbox Gallery, but I have no idea how to solve this. Right now, the plugin is still deactivated because being redirected is a better option than a messed-up frame without picture, but I’m hoping someone can help me out. I’ve already Googled the problem and browsed through the forums, but haven’t found a solution.

    Not sure if it helps in your case, but the new galleries in wp 3.5 seem to generate different code.

    When you insert a gallery now, it reads something like.

    [gallery ids="411737,411733,411736,411735,411732,411734"]

    Change this to
    [gallery ids="411737,411733,411736,411735,411732,411734" link="file"]
    or just
    [gallery link="file"] and lightboxes should work again.
